Aurelia Morawiec‐Knysak is a scholar working on Immunology, Nephrology and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Aurelia Morawiec‐Knysak has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 340 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Immunology, 4 papers in Nephrology and 3 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Aurelia Morawiec‐Knysak’s work include Renal Diseases and Glomerulopathies (4 papers), Immunodeficiency and Autoimmune Disorders (3 papers) and T-cell and B-cell Immunology (2 papers). Aurelia Morawiec‐Knysak is often cited by papers focused on Renal Diseases and Glomerulopathies (4 papers), Immunodeficiency and Autoimmune Disorders (3 papers) and T-cell and B-cell Immunology (2 papers). Aurelia Morawiec‐Knysak collaborates with scholars based in Poland and United Kingdom. Aurelia Morawiec‐Knysak's co-authors include Iwona Palczewska, Anna Wasilewska, Huiqi Pan, Małgorzata Zajączkowska, Beata Gurzkowska, Anna Moczulska, Aneta Grajda, Zbigniew Kułaga, Marcin Tkaczyk and Ewelina Napieralska and has published in prestigious journals such as International Journal of Molecular Sciences, Pediatric Nephrology and European Journal of Pediatrics.
